SUMMARY:
The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) Administrator signed an order dated May 5, 2026, denying a petition dated January 1, 2025, from the Environmental Protection Information Center and the Humboldt Coalition for Clean Energy. The Petition requested that the EPA object to a Clean Air Act (CAA) title V operating permit issued by the North Coast Unified Air Quality Management District (NCUAQMD) to Humboldt Redwood Company, LLC, sawmill (“HRC facility”) for its lumber manufacturing and electric generating facility located in Humboldt County, California.
S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ION:
The EPA received a petition from the Environmental Protection Information Center and the Humboldt Coalition for Clean Energy dated January 1, 2025, requesting that the EPA object to the issuance of operating permit No. NCU 060-12, issued by the NCUAQMD to the HRC facility in Humboldt County, California. On May 5, 2026, the EPA Administrator issued an order denying the petition. The order explains the basis for the EPA's decision.
Sections 307(b) and 505(b)(2) of the CAA provide that a petitioner may request judicial review of those portions of an order that deny issues in a petition. Any petition for review shall be filed in the United States Court of Appeals for the appropriate circuit no later than August 24, 2026.
